Job Description  | Financial Aid and Scholarships at Texas State University seeks an experienced systems support specialist to maintain and enhance the office’s technology resources.
Job Duties  | Job DescriptionReporting to the Senior Administrative Assistant of Financial Aid and Scholarships, the Systems Support Specialist II is responsible for the day-to-day maintenance, trouble-shooting, and upgrading of all hardware and software (e.g., phone recording system, check-in system, etc.). This position is also charged with training staff on various applications (e.g., document imaging system) and providing technical back-up in the design, development, testing and implementation of PC, .NET and other custom applications. In addition, this individual is responsible for maintaining and developing the departmental web and related sites, maintaining an inventory of software, hardware and licenses, as well as developing and implementing effectively a plan to address systems compliance, data integrity and systems security.

Job Duties The Systems Support Specialist II will need to be knowledgeable of best practices with respect to computer hardware, software and network management as well as work collaboratively with IT staff and other departments to facilitate a systematic and comprehensive approach to ensuring compliance, excellent customer service and business efficiency. This position must keep abreast of all pertinent system changes, take action as necessary to facilitate proactive business operations, possess the ability to assume responsibility, set goals, and estimate effectively target dates for major project deliverables.
